Necessary tools and preparation of the workplace
Before starting the active phase of work, you need to make sure that you have all the required tools at hand. Lack of the required screwdriver or wrench in the middle of the process can lead to damage to fasteners or stripped threads. Usually, a standard set of household tools that any man has is sufficient for the job.
You will definitely need a flat-blade screwdriver to remove decorative panels and plugs. You will also need a Phillips screwdriver (most often size PH2 or PH3) to unscrew the main bolts. In some models, especially built-in or heavy two-chamber units, a wrench or socket head of 8 mm may be required. ⚠️ Attention: Before starting any work, be sure to disconnect the refrigerator from the power supply! This is critical for your safety, as you will be working in close proximity to electrical components and wiring.
Particular attention should be paid to organizing your workspace. Clear the area in front of and on the sides of the refrigerator to allow easy access from all sides. Remove any mats that may interfere with stability and provide a flat surface where removed parts can be temporarily placed. If your model has a freezer compartment No Frost, make sure that you do not damage the delicate sensors when removing the panels.

Dismantling the upper and lower doors: step-by-step algorithm
Removal process doors always starts with freeing up the internal space. Remove all shelves, containers and food. This will not only make the design easier, but will also protect the contents from falling and breaking during manipulation. An empty door is much easier and safer to remove.
The first step is to remove the top cover of the refrigerator, if it is structurally provided. It is usually secured with latches or a few screws at the back. After this, open access to the top hinge. Carefully unscrew the mounting bolts, but do not remove them completely until the door is secured by an assistant. The refrigerator door weighs a lot, and falling an unsecured element can cause injury or damage to the floor.
After removing the top hinge, carefully lift the door and remove it from the bottom axis. Place it in a safe place, preferably resting it against the wall on a soft base. Now let's move on to the bottom. Here the algorithm is similar: remove the decorative panel, unscrew the bottom hinge. If you have a two-chamber refrigerator, then the middle part (partition) may also require dismantling or turning over.
What to do if the bolts are rusty?
If the fasteners do not give in, do not use excessive force so as not to tear off the cap. Treat the threads with a penetrating lubricant (eg WD-40) and leave for 10-15 minutes. After this, try to carefully remove the bolt with a wrench with a large lever arm.
When working with the bottom door, it is often difficult to access the fasteners due to the plinth grille or drawers. In such cases, it may be necessary to temporarily remove the bottom freezer drawers. Proceed carefully so as not to damage the plastic guides, which become fragile in the cold.
Rearranging the fittings and strike plates
The most important step is reinstalling the fittings on the opposite side. On the free side of the case you will find holes closed with plastic plugs. They need to be removed. To do this, carefully pry them off with a flat-head screwdriver. There will be holes on the old side where the hinges were, which now need to be closed with these plugs.
Pay attention to the door handle. In some models it is symmetrical and does not require changes. However, if the handle is asymmetrical or recessed, it may need to be flipped or the fasteners rearranged. Often this requires removing the inner door panel to gain access to the screws securing the handle from the inside.

Do not forget about the magnetic stopper (closer), if it is provided for in the design. It is located in the lower part of the body and prevents the door from opening spontaneously if it is skewed. It also needs to be moved to the new side by unscrewing it from the old hole and screwing it into the new one. Often the same tool is used for this as for hinges.
Features of hanging doors in two-chamber models
In two-chamber models In refrigerators, the process is complicated by the presence of a middle partition and, often, a separate sealing system between the chambers. Here it is critical to correctly reinstall the central hinge, which holds the lower door and serves as support for the upper one. An error at this stage will result in the doors being warped and the seal will not fit tightly.
In models with the system No Frost electrical wires that power the fan or upper chamber sensors may pass through the hinges. When dismantling the upper door, proceed with extreme caution. Wire cable Do not pull or bend at an acute angle. Often the wires are hidden inside the hinge channel, and they must be carefully released or, conversely, pulled through a new hole.
- 🔌 Disconnect the wire connectors before completely removing the door if they are in the way.
- 🧵 Make sure that the wires are not sandwiched between the metal parts of the loop.
- 🔩 Make sure that the middle loop is installed strictly horizontally.
- ❄️ Check the integrity of the seal between the chambers after installation.
If your refrigerator has a display on the door, the task becomes even more difficult. In this case, the wires go to the control panel and their length may be limited. Sometimes, to rehang such a door, it is necessary to extend the wires or resolder the contacts, which is best left to a specialist. However, in many modern models the cables have sufficient length for transfer.
⚠️ Attention: When working with wiring inside the loops, make sure that the insulation of the wires is not damaged by sharp metal edges. Any short circuit can damage the electronic control module of the refrigerator.
Adjustment position and tightness check
After all the elements have been rearranged and the doors have been installed in their new places, the adjustment stage begins. The door should close tightly, without distortions or gaps. If you notice that the door does not fit tightly or, conversely, is too tight, you need to adjust the installation height using the adjusting screws on the hinges.
Checking the tightness is a mandatory step. Take a piece of paper or a banknote and clamp it around the perimeter of the door. The paper should be pulled out with force, but not torn. If in some place the paper falls out freely or is removed too easily, it means that the pressure there is broken. In this case, slightly loosen the screws securing the hinge and change the tilt of the door, then tighten the fasteners again.
It is also worth paying attention to the operation of the magnetic lock. The door should close on its own if you open it about 30-40 degrees. If the door does not “reach” all the way and remains ajar, check whether the stopper is installed correctly at the bottom and whether something is preventing the free movement of the mechanism. It may be necessary to adjust the tilt of the entire refrigerator using the front support legs.
Common mistakes and ways to eliminate them
Even following the instructions, beginners often make mistakes that later affect the operation of the equipment. One of the most common is mixing up the sides of the hinges. Before tightening the bolts tightly, make sure that the hinge fits exactly as it was in the original, just on the mirror side. Incorrect installation can cause the door axis to protrude inward, preventing it from opening.
Another common problem is lost or mixed up plugs. If you lose the plastic plug, do not leave the hole open. Dust and moisture will get into it, which can cause corrosion of the housing. You can temporarily seal the hole with electrical tape that matches the color of the body, but it is better to order a set of plugs from the manufacturer.
Sometimes after rehanging the door begins to creak. This means that the rubbing surfaces of the hinges are not lubricated or the lubricant has dried out. Use special silicone grease or lithium grease for household appliances. Do not use vegetable oil or grease, as they thicken or oxidize over time, creating a sticky mass that collects dirt.
What to do if, after rearranging, the door does not close tightly?
Check whether anything inside the refrigerator (food, shelves) is preventing it from closing tightly. Make sure the rubber seal is clean and not deformed. If there are no mechanical obstacles, try warming the seal with a hairdryer (without overheating!) or adjusting the tilt of the door with adjusting bolts.
Is it possible to rearrange the door if the refrigerator is built into the kitchen unit?
This is more difficult, but possible. You will need to pull the refrigerator completely out of the niche to gain access to the sides. Make sure your kitchen cabinet doors also allow you to open the refrigerator from the new side. Often, built-in models require special long bolts to attach decorative furniture fronts.
Do I need to wait after turning on if I kept the door open for a long time?
If you held the door open for a long time while operating, the compressor could overheat, trying to compensate for the loss of cold. After completing the work and connecting it to the network, it is advisable to let the refrigerator stand for 2-3 hours without loading food, so that the temperature conditions stabilize.
